First day — facilities desk. Landlord audit today: Harwick Estates rep walks the site 10:00–12:00. Before they arrive: clear fire-exit corridors, check extinguisher tags on Levels 2–4, confirm riser cupboards are locked, and print the maintenance log. Escort the rep at all times; they have no badge. Note any defects they raise on the snag sheet, same day. The riser cupboards and plant room open off the master keypad — use the code below.

staff pass of kawep-hahap = bdg-IEUUF-6

## Changelog — BuildMesh 4.2.1

**Changed defaults: clock skew tolerance between build agents**

Previous releases allowed up to 90 seconds of clock skew between agents before artifact signing failed, which masked NTP drift on the Varnholm fleet. The default tolerance is now 15 seconds, and agents emit a warning at 10 seconds. Support should expect a short spike in tickets from teams with misconfigured time sync; point them to the agent setup guide. For reference, the shipped defaults are reproduced below as configuration values.

deployment values, kajep-kageg:
[praix]
host = praix.paliqcorp.corp
user = praix_svc
database = praix_prod

### FAQ: Why does the user-module split need a sealed migration key?

When we carved the user module out of the Bramblecore monolith, the data migration tooling was locked behind an encrypted bundle so reviewers can't accidentally run it against production. To open the bundle in your review sandbox, use the passphrase below.

unlock words, yawig-kagef: gordor-holvan-ulaael-pramir-ulaiel-tamdor

Minutes — Management Meeting, Dunhaven Foods

Attendees: heads of department. Main item: renewal of the Petrick Cold Chain contract. Terms broadly unchanged; volume discount improves slightly from month four. Rasha flagged the penalty clause — legal will tidy the wording. Everyone happy to proceed, pending sign-off. Next review in six months. The commercially sensitive context is set out in the note below.

management briefing: The renewal with Zoraelax Group closes at $10 million a year, 15 percent below the last contract. Project Ralael slips by six weeks because of the audit delay.